Opcon Power operation - unique technology for generating electricity from waste heat
Energy and environmental technology Group Opcon is now operating the first set Opcon Power at the CHP plant in Eskilstuna, where the supply of electricity into the grid. The plant that extracts electricity from surplus heat from the 55 C works and supply electricity in accordance with the calculations.
Opcon Power has now been operating at Eskilstuna CHP plant, where it is tested and works as a reference plant.
- The plant operates electricity and supplies in accordance with our calculations. We produce electricity from hot water, which in many cases so far only been lost. In Europe alone it is estimated today to be over 300 TWh of waste heat in industries that do not get to use, but cooled off and drained into the nearest watercourse. Would all the energy is recovered by Opcon Power so would the order of 30 TWh of electricity could be produced without any additional emissions. It represents almost half of electricity generation from the Swedish hydropower. The investment cost per produced kWh is on half the investment cost of wind power, says Opcon president and CEO Rolf Hasselström.
Opcon Power is addressed primarily to process and power generation from large amounts of waste heat in the form of hot water. Individual large industries may have been around 1TWh unused waste heat in the form of hot water with the help of some 30 Opcon Power could supply about 100 GWh of electricity a year.
Opcon Power can also be adapted to supply electricity on board the larger vessel and is expected to then be able to reduce oil consumption by 5-10 percent.
A Opcon Power costs between $ 7-10 million depending on operating conditions and is expected to deliver 3 500 MWh per year of continuous service in the industry.
